Self-service MachinesThe self-service machine industry relies heavily on paper handling machines to process currency and checks, and perform billing and other administrative tasks. ATM, ticket handling and postal equipment require precise movement at high speeds, with a constant coefficient of friction so as to avoid jamming or double-feeds.
Traditional rubber components generate tribocharge from friction, but semi-conductive urethane components effectively control charge density for precise toner dispensing. They also reduce tribocharge buildup eliminating potential fire hazards and preventing paper jams during transport. Furthermore, MPC’s specially formulated antistatic components eliminate the need for carbon black or metallic brushes typically used to control ESD in critical paper handling applications.
MPC’s Durethane® polymers are the material of choice for sensitive self-service machine components like rollers, wheels, pick pads, and foam conveyors. Our formulations possess an excellent compression set, a high coefficient of friction, and unique self-cleaning properties that make them ideal for high-volume paper moving applications.

Electronics
MPC urethanes are used in antistatic drive belts for silicon wafer transport and also play a vital role in micro-circuitry protection. Applying a thin film top-coat of a highly conductive urethane to computer chips, circuit boards, and other electronic components prevents the buildup and potentially destructive discharge of static electricity in sensitive micro-circuitry.

Marine
Castable urethanes are extremely resistant to the swelling and degenerative effects of water immersion and have excellent long-term stability, making them the ideal choice for a variety of marine applications.
MPC manufactures Durethane DS with a hardness of 50A-80D for use in Naval underwater applications. We’ve also cast tough and flexible ether-based urethanes for use in underwater cable connectors. Ether-based urethanes are specially formulated to prevent bacteria growth and sustain the high pressure and extreme temperatures found in deep-sea environments.

Medical
Ether-based or ester-based MDI urethanes with hardness factors ranging from 30A-95A are commonly used for both medical and FDA applications. Urethane prepolymers are cured with special medical and FDA grade curatives. Other castable silicone rubber formulations are used in applications where surface release characteristics and high temperatures (400˚F) are required. You’ll find our medical-grade urethane rollers in a number of medical printing devices including those used for X-ray machines and heart monitors.

Telecomunications
MPC manufactures semi-conductive urethanes with volume resistivities ranging from 1E8 ohm.cm to 5E9 ohm.cm for use in a variety of antistatic applications in the telecommunications industry. You’ll find these materials in carrying cases for electronics components and in conductive conveyer belt systems used for transporting cards and disks in clean room applications. Semi-conductive urethane is often used for electronic outfits to reduce static buildup and the potentially destructive discharge of static electricity. In fact, anti-static properties are required by ISO for the use of electronic covering materials.

Textiles
High-performance, wear-resistant urethanes with a hardness range of 60A to 60D have been used in high-speed textile thread-weaving machines because they provide a stable and consistent coefficient of friction. The result is fewer manufacturing defects and less downtime. By blending a conductive agent into the urethane formulation, we’re able to reduce the potential for generating static electricity and sparks, especially in dry, cold manufacturing environments. Antistatic polyurethanes are also used in textile printing, dyeing, and finishing processes.

Water Utilities
Ether-based urethanes have relatively good reversion resistance in high humidity. They possess superior physical and mechanical properties compared to rubbers with the same hardness. Ether-based urethanes are commonly used in parts that are either immersed in water for extended periods of time or exposed to harsh environmental conditions and weather extremes. For example, you’ll find these durable, wear-resistant urethane formulations in fin paddles for boats, and in the rollers used in car wash conveyor systems. Our lightweight, closed-cell, rigid foams are commonly used in the manufacture of surfboards and life saving flotation devices.
